«Breaking News» Defqon.1 music festival: Paramedic joins in with the crowd and dances at controversial event

A paramedic has turned entertainer at the Defqon.1 music festival, joining the crowd of ravers and showing off his best dance moves.


As the music heaved and thousands of scantily-dressed hardstyle fans danced, the temptation proved too much for one hi-vis wearing ambulance worker.


One impressed festival-goer captured the video of the male paramedic performing a unique interpretation of 'muzzing' - the dance style of choice for most in attendance.

Viewed more than 55,000 times on Facebook the video shows the paramedic going all out, much to the enjoyment of those watching on.


Throwing his arms around his head in unique fashion, the man's moves drew cheers and laughs from those nearby.


The man's colleague, watching on, was seemingly unimpressed by his efforts - leaning against a tree with his arms crossed and refusing to join in.

But it wasn't all fun and games for the 30,000 in attendance on Saturday afternoon.


Two revellers have been confirmed dead after allegedly overdosing on illicit drugs at the Sydney International Regata Centre, in Penrith, in the city's west.


Joseph Pham, 23, has been identified as one of the two dead partygoers, while a 21-year-old woman from Melbourne also died at the event.

More than 700 other people sought assistance from medical professionals.


Police charged 10 people with drug supply offences, including two girls aged 17 and one man who was allegedly caught with more than 250 grams of MDMA.


New South Wales Premier Gladys Berejiklian vowed to stop the festival being held in 2019, declaring the event 'unsafe'.


'I'm absolutely aghast at what's occurred. I don't want any family to go through the tragedy that some families are waking up to this morning,' she said.


'This is an unsafe event and I'll be doing everything I can to make sure it never happens again.


'I never want to see this event held in Sydney or NSW ever again... Young lives were lost for no reason.'
